Transaction 38e5030a2205260ab94ae656d69603d594a62ace5d2f2ebd1cc5fa355e20089d
1 Input
1 Output
-
38e5030a2205260ab94ae656d69603d594a62ace5d2f2ebd1cc5fa355e20089d:0
- value
- 149899
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1db375c1c808031eeaf62f6c60ef1f7b2d0c8c71 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13i3afNomNiSCZwn3Tm6RXZtubqJx4W4aT